A web‐based problem‐solving environment designed to teach assembly line balancing was developed based on analytic and simulation models. This environment was evaluated by 67 undergraduate students. Differences between pre‐ and post‐test scores were significant ( α  = 0.05) and students felt that the system helped them to visualize line balancing concepts. © 2008 Wiley Periodicals, Inc.
